APC inaugurates Tinubu/Shettima presidential campaign council in Canada

The All Progressives Congress (APC) has inaugurated its presidential campaign council in Canada to ensure victory for its presidential candidate, Bola Tinubu, and his running mate, Kassim Shettima, in the February 2023 presidential election.
A spokesman for the council, Abiola Oshodi, announced this in a statement on Wednesday.
Mr Oshodi said the council was ready to spread the APC tentacles in Canada and will ensure that Nigerians in Canada support the Tinubu/Shettima candidate.
He added that the council would put measures to increase the general acceptability of the party’s presidential candidate, especially outside the shores of Nigeria.
In his acceptance speech, the chairman of the campaign council, Jide Oladejo, thanked the leadership of the party for counting him and other council members worthy to serve.
Mr Oladejo assured the party leadership that the confidence reposed on the council would be treasured and well-guided.
According to him, Mr Tinubu has what it takes to give birth to a united, prosperous Nigeria come May 2023. Oladejo said accumulated wrongs of past administrations caused the rot in Nigeria’s system dragging the country backwards.
